系统部署环境搭建经验分享:Ubuntu Server安装过程中的常见问题
在Linux内核安全和系统管理实践中,Ubuntu Server的安装配置是构建安全基础设施的第一步。本文将分享在实际部署中遇到的典型问题及解决方案。
安装过程中的核心安全配置
1. 磁盘分区优化
对于服务器环境,建议采用以下分区策略以增强系统稳定性与安全性:
# 创建分区表并设置合理的挂载点
sudo fdisk /dev/sda
# 主分区:/boot (500M), root (/), swap (2x内存大小)
2. 网络安全配置
安装完成后,立即配置防火墙策略:
# 安装并启用ufw
sudo apt update && sudo apt install ufw -y
sudo ufw default deny incoming
sudo ufw default allow outgoing
sudo ufw allow ssh
sudo ufw enable
3. 用户权限控制
为避免root直接登录,应创建专用管理员账户:
# 创建管理员用户并设置sudo权限
sudo adduser adminuser
sudo usermod -aG sudo adminuser
# 禁用root登录
sudo passwd -l root
内核安全加固建议
在内核层面,推荐启用以下安全机制:
- SELinux/AppArmor配置
- 禁用不必要内核模块
- 启用内核地址空间布局随机化(ASLR)
以上实践可显著提升系统部署环境的安全性。

讨论